How many bags of hair for box braids? This is a question that is often asked by women who are looking to get box braids. The answer to this question depends on the length and thickness of the hair that you want.
If you want box braids that are shoulder-length or shorter, you will need one to two bags of hair. If you want box braids that are longer than shoulder-length, you will need two to three bags of hair. If you want box braids that are very thick, you will need three or four bags of hair.
It is important to keep in mind that the amount of hair that you need will also depend on the style of box braids that you want. For example, if you want box braids that are tightly braided, you will need more hair than if you want box braids that are loosely braided.
If you are not sure how much hair you need, it is best to purchase a little extra so that you have enough to complete your desired style.
